What happens when the frequency of a photon decreases? The energy of the photon depends on its frequency (how fast the electric field and magnetic field wiggle). The higher the frequency, the more energy the photon has. As the frequency of a photon goes up, the wavelength () goes down, and as the frequency goes […]

What happens if you have familial hypercholesterolemia? People with FH have increased blood levels of low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ol, sometimes called “bad cholesterol.” Having too much LDL cholesterol in your blood increases your risk for developing coronary artery disease or having a heart attack. Why do we use Laplace Transform? The Laplace transform has a number of properties that make it useful for analyzing linear dynamical systems. The transform turns integral equations and differential equations to polynomial equations, which are much easier to solve.
